Trio of big cctld sales on Monday including the largest reported .Be sale of all time

March 10, 2020 by Raymond Hackney

Monday saw three big country code sales with Perfectos.be leading the way at $51,270. This is the biggest reported sale for the Belgian cctld. Namebio has 803 recorded sales totaling $2.1 million. .Co.uk dominated cctld sales in 2016

January 26, 2017 by Raymond Hackney
